如何从一个ng视图到另一个视图创建缩放动画?

时间:2013-07-25 13:50:22

标签: javascript css animation angularjs

我的屏幕将分为4个相等的矩形,每个矩形都有一个图表。我希望用户能够点击图表和应用程序然后放大到一个新视图,即该图表作为整个页面。 / p>

所以我想要设置:

app / charts显示所有图表。然后当用户选择图表(比如图表-1)时,应用程序会导航到app / charts / chart-1。

我希望点击的图表展开到视图中,直到它占据整个屏幕(新视图)。

我愿意接受任何方法。 CSS,javascript库,黑客(可能只是使用一个视图并放大所选的div?)我希望能够通过url导航到全屏图表...

谢谢,任何帮助表示赞赏。

1 个答案:

答案 0 :(得分:0)

<div class="wrapper  {selected_class}">
  <div ng-click="selected_class='top-left'" class="top-left"></div>
  <div ng-click="selected_class='top-right'" class="top-right"></div>
  <div ng-click="selected_class='bottom-left'" class="bottom-left"></div>
  <div ng-click="selected_class='bottom-right'" class="bottom-right"></div>
</div>


.top-left .top-left{ transform:scale(2); } etc